Diamond Diplomacy: Unveiling the US-Japan Bond Through Baseball | Official Trailer (2026)

The world of cinema and sports has witnessed an intriguing development with the acquisition of 'Diamond Diplomacy' by Strand Releasing. This documentary, directed by Yuriko Gamo Romer, delves into the unique cultural and historical connection between the United States and Japan, using baseball as its narrative thread.

What immediately stands out to me is the film's ambitious scope. It traces baseball's journey from its introduction to Japan in 1872 to its current global influence, with a particular focus on the rise of star player Shohei Ohtani. Through this lens, 'Diamond Diplomacy' offers a fresh perspective on how sports can serve as a cultural bridge, reflecting the diplomatic, conflictual, and exchange-driven relationship between two nations.

The film's journey so far has been impressive. It premiered at the Mill Valley Film Festival in 2025 and has since been screened at prestigious festivals like the Hot Springs Documentary Film Festival and the Hawaii International Film Festival. Its recognition as runner-up for the Library of Congress Lavine/Ken Burns Prize for Film further solidifies its impact and importance in the documentary realm.

From my perspective, the acquisition deal between Strand Releasing and the film's team is a significant step. Strand, known for its support of independent cinema, sees 'Diamond Diplomacy' as a powerful story that will resonate deeply with audiences. The film's director, Yuriko Gamo Romer, expressed excitement about partnering with Strand, citing their legacy of promoting bold and meaningful cinema.

The plan for a national rollout and a theatrical release in the fall suggests a confident strategy to bring this documentary to a wide audience.
